Overview

This video explores the intriguing phenomenon of déjà vu, the feeling of having already experienced a current situation. It delves into scientific theories attempting to explain this sensation, including potential glitches in the brain's memory system, the concept of parallel processing where information pathways are slightly out of sync, and connections to the temporal lobe responsible for memory. The video also touches upon how stress and fatigue might influence these experiences, acknowledging that while research is ongoing, a definitive explanation for déjà vu remains elusive, highlighting its complexity within human cognition and perception.

Chapters

  • Deja vu is the eerie sensation of experiencing something familiar even when it's new.
  • The term 'deja vu' is French for 'already seen'.
  • It's a fleeting and often unsettling feeling that has puzzled people for a long time.
Understanding what déjà vu is helps frame the scientific inquiry into this common yet mysterious human experience.
Strolling through a foreign city and feeling like you've been there before, despite never having visited.
  • One theory suggests déjà vu is a temporary glitch in the brain's memory system, confusing the present with the past.
  • Another explanation, parallel processing, proposes that different brain pathways process information at slightly different speeds, creating a false sense of prior experience.
  • Research links déjà vu to the temporal lobe, suggesting a brief misfiring in this memory-related area could be the cause.
These theories provide potential mechanisms for how déjà vu occurs, moving beyond mere speculation to scientific hypotheses.
A brain pathway processing visual information slightly faster than the auditory pathway, making a sound seem like it was heard before the visual event.
  • Studies indicate a connection between déjà vu experiences and states of stress and fatigue.
  • These conditions may alter how the brain processes information, potentially leading to the sensation.
  • Despite research, a definitive scientific explanation for déjà vu remains elusive.
Recognizing contributing factors like stress and fatigue offers practical insights into when déjà vu might be more likely to occur.
Experiencing déjà vu more frequently when feeling tired or under pressure.
